Ghana’s WBO Africa Light heavyweight Champion, Braimah Kamoko who is popularly referred to as Bukom Banku has promised to defeat his opponent, Hamza Wandera from Uganda at the Accra Sports stadium on Saturday.
The fight is Banku’s third title defence and a win will inch him closer to a world title fight against British boxer, Nathan Cleverly.
Banku was almost disqualified on Friday during the weighing after he missed out on the required weight on several attempts.
He had to run around the stadium to lose some weight before finally making the 175 pounds threshold.
Bukom Banku told XYZ Sports that his opponent will not survive in the ring.
Meanwhile, the trainer of Banku’s opponent, Paul Otel says they are prepared for the bout.
He said his boxer has been prepared from the beginning that is why he was able to meet the weight requirement unlike his opponent.
He believes Wandera will beat the undefeated Ghanaian come Saturday.
